Le 26/12/2024 à 22:49, Shree Ramamoorthy a écrit :
> Use chip ID and chip_data struct to differentiate between devices in
> probe(). Add TPS65215 resource information. Update descriptions and
> copyright information to reflect the driver supports 2 PMIC devices.
>
> Signed-off-by: Shree Ramamoorthy <s-ramamoorthy@ti.com>
...
> +static struct chip_data chip_info_table[] = {
> + [TPS65219] = {
> + .irq_chip = &tps65219_irq_chip,
> + .cells = tps65219_cells,
> + .n_cells = ARRAY_SIZE(tps65219_cells),
> + },
> + [TPS65215] = {
Maybe keep alphabetical order?
> + .irq_chip = &tps65215_irq_chip,
> + .cells = tps65215_cells,
> + .n_cells = ARRAY_SIZE(tps65215_cells),
> + },
> +};
> +
> static int tps65219_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
> {
> struct tps65219 *tps;
> + struct chip_data *pmic;
> bool pwr_button;
> int ret;
>
> @@ -231,6 +366,8 @@ static int tps65219_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
> i2c_set_clientdata(client, tps);
>
> tps->dev = &client->dev;
> + tps->chip_id = (uintptr_t)i2c_get_match_data(client);
> + pmic = &chip_info_table[tps->chip_id];
>
> tps->regmap = devm_regmap_init_i2c(client, &tps65219_regmap_config);
> if (IS_ERR(tps->regmap)) {
> @@ -239,14 +376,14 @@ static int tps65219_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
> return ret;
> }
>
> - ret = devm_regmap_add_irq_chip(&client->dev, tps->regmap, client->irq,
> - IRQF_ONESHOT, 0, &tps65219_irq_chip,
> + ret = devm_regmap_add_irq_chip(tps->dev, tps->regmap, client->irq,
> + IRQF_ONESHOT, 0, pmic->irq_chip,
> &tps->irq_data);
> if (ret)
> return ret;
>
> ret = devm_mfd_add_devices(tps->dev, PLATFORM_DEVID_AUTO,
> - tps65219_cells, ARRAY_SIZE(tps65219_cells),
> + pmic->cells, pmic->n_cells,
> NULL, 0, regmap_irq_get_domain(tps->irq_data));
> if (ret) {
> dev_err(tps->dev, "Failed to add child devices: %d\n", ret);
> @@ -284,7 +421,8 @@ static int tps65219_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
> }
>
> static const struct of_device_id of_tps65219_match_table[] = {
> - { .compatible = "ti,tps65219", },
> + { .compatible = "ti,tps65219", .data = (void *)TPS65219, },
> + { .compatible = "ti,tps65215", .data = (void *)TPS65215, },
Maybe keep alphabetical order?
> {}
> };
> M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, of_tps65219_match_table);
> @@ -299,5 +437,5 @@ static struct i2c_driver tps65219_driver = {
> module_i2c_driver(tps65219_driver);
>
> MODULE_AUTHOR("Jerome Neanne <jneanne@baylibre.com>");
> -MODULE_DESCRIPTION("TPS65219 power management IC driver");
> +MODULE_DESCRIPTION("TPS65215/TPS65219 PMIC driver");
> M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
